Hello,

i've a xerox docucolor 240, I've bought the printer second hand and there were some töner cartridges with it. Now my question is how long can I use those and how long can you keep them? I read some were that the durability is very long, they can not dry out? But is it bad for the system, can it lead to constipation in my töner channels?

Some one who have experience with this??? Thx a lot in front!!

Wim from Belgium
 
Maybe one of the techs here can offer you a better answer, but from a practical standpoint, I would be very surprised if you run into any quality issues using toner/developer that is 1-3 years old. With our previous canons we've used toner/drums (w.developer) that has been 5 years old without any visible issue. In practice, I wouldn't worry about it if you just have less than a dozen on hand.
